Gijang County, Busan Holds Policy Consultation Meeting with People Power Party

Close Cooperation for Securing National and Municipal Funding
and Addressing Local Issues

Gijang County (Mayor Jung Jongbok) held the "2025 1st Gijang County-People Power Party Policy Consultation Meeting" at 3 p.m. on September 23 at Gijang County Office.


The meeting was attended by Jung Jongbok, Mayor of Gijang County, 17 senior county officials, Jung Dongman, member of the National Assembly, Park Hongbok, Chairman of the Gijang County Council, and all county council members affiliated with the People Power Party.

During the meeting, participants engaged in in-depth discussions on key issues aimed at improving the quality of life for residents and ensuring the sustainable development of Gijang County, while seeking close cooperation measures.


Mayor Jung Jongbok explained projects supported by national and municipal funds, as well as major pending issues, and requested full support from the party to secure these funds and ensure smooth implementation.


Key agenda items included the Gijang Skywalk construction project, the Banggok District natural disaster risk improvement project, the Southern Region wide-area tourism development project, and the Ilgwang New Town bypass road construction project. In addition, collaboration was requested to secure sufficient municipal funding for the creation of a sports park in Gijang-eup, the construction of a road between Daebyeon and Jukseong Intersections, and the plan to develop waterfront spaces along local rivers in Gijang-eup, all aimed at expanding cultural facilities and improving transportation networks.


Other topics included a proposal to revise the implementation guidelines for support projects in areas surrounding power plants, the construction of a comprehensive stadium in Ilgwang Recreation Area, and the establishment of a new comprehensive social welfare center in Jeonggwan, along with in-depth discussions on long-standing resident demands and major current issues.


Mayor Jung Jongbok stated, "Organic cooperation between the party and the administration is essential to achieve our shared goals of developing Gijang and ensuring the happiness of our residents," and added, "I earnestly request active support so that the national and municipal projects and local issues discussed today can proceed without any setbacks."


National Assembly member Jung Dongman said, "We will spare no effort to provide active support together with city and county council members so that the county's key initiatives can be successfully completed," and added, "We will work together to create policies that meet the expectations of our residents."
